In the heart of Homewood's city hall, a vision for the future of the Creekside project began to take shape during the Planning Commission meeting on April 1, 2025. City officials and community stakeholders gathered to discuss a comprehensive approach to development that emphasizes collaboration and environmental stewardship.

The meeting kicked off with a call for enhanced community engagement, a theme that resonated throughout the discussions. The proposal to establish a Development Advisory Group was a focal point, aimed at bringing together diverse community interests to address key issues surrounding the Creekside project. This group would serve as a bridge between the developers and the community, ensuring that feedback is not only heard but actively integrated into the planning process.

As the conversation unfolded, the importance of a comprehensive master plan was underscored. This plan would not only guide the development of Creekside but also set forth a series of covenants and restrictions that would govern future projects within the area. The intent is clear: to create a cohesive and well-thought-out development that reflects the community's needs and aspirations.

Environmental considerations were also at the forefront of the discussions. The developers expressed a commitment to responsible land use and environmental stewardship, highlighting the collaboration with academic institutions to create a project that could serve as a model for sustainable development. The goal is to ensure that the Creekside project not only meets the immediate needs of the community but also stands the test of time, fostering pride among residents for generations to come.

Questions from the commission members revealed a desire for clarity on the process moving forward. There was a consensus that while the master plan would provide a framework for development, any significant changes would require further review and approval from the commission. This ensures that the community remains informed and involved as the project progresses.

As the meeting concluded, the developers reiterated their commitment to transparency and collaboration, seeking the commission's support to move forward with this ambitious vision. The hope is that through this inclusive approach, the Creekside project will not only enhance the landscape of Homewood but also serve as a testament to what can be achieved when a community comes together with a shared purpose.
